Stop animation in general has a hard time recently, Kubo and 2 strings / Box troll were clearly for kid and family with a level of acclaim quite high, did not go over 50m, Pirates band of misfits did 31m, Shaun of the Sheep 19m.

 

Hard to imagine a Wes Anderson movie making much more than those.

 

The last success story a large scale for stopped animation, is it Coraline (that made 124.5m WW on is 60m budget) ? That is going close to 10 year's ago. Chicken run was in 2000.

 

It is really hard if you are not pixar/dreamwork looking style animation.
